Alabama Code § 34-32-18

Penalty for Violations
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
Any person who violates any provision of this chapter shall be guilty of a misdemeanor and for each offense for which he or she is convicted shall be punished by a fine of not more than $500 or by imprisonment in the county jail for not more than three months or by both.
